Crawlspace waterproofing services focus on preventing water intrusion and moisture buildup beneath a building's foundation. These services typically involve installing barriers such as vapor barriers or sealants to block ground moisture from seeping into the crawlspace. Additionally, contractors may set up drainage systems, sump pumps, and dehumidifiers to manage water flow and control humidity levels. The goal is to create a dry, stable environment beneath the property, which can help protect the structural integrity and reduce the risk of mold growth.

The overview below groups typical Crawlspace Waterproofing proj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in New Oxford, PA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Basic Waterproofing - The typical cost for basic crawlspace waterproofing ranges from $1,500 to $3,500. This usually includes sealing cracks and installing a sump pump to prevent moisture buildup.
Advanced Systems - More comprehensive waterproofing solutions can cost between $3,500 and $7,000. These often involve exterior waterproofing, drainage systems, and vapor barriers for enhanced protection.
Inspection and Assessment - Professional inspections generally cost between $200 and $500. This fee covers evaluating the crawlspace and recommending appropriate waterproofing measures.
Additional Repairs - Repair costs for existing damage or structural issues may add $1,000 to $4,000 to the overall expense. These repairs are often necessary before waterproofing can be effectively installed.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is crawlspace waterproofing? Crawlspace waterproofing involves methods to prevent water intrusion and moisture buildup in a crawlspace, helping to protect the home’s foundation and indoor air quality.
Why is waterproofing a crawlspace important? Waterproofing helps prevent mold growth, wood rot, and structural damage caused by excess moisture and water leaks in the crawlspace area.
What services do local pros offer for crawlspace waterproofing? Local service providers typically offer inspections, sealing, drainage systems, sump pump installation, and moisture barrier installation to waterproof crawlspaces.
How can I tell if my crawlspace needs waterproofing? Signs include persistent dampness, mold or musty odors, visible water intrusion, or wood framing that appears warped or rotted.
How do professionals typically waterproof a crawlspace? They may install vapor barriers, improve drainage, seal vents, and set up sump pumps to manage water and moisture effectively.
